DIRECTOR'S REPORT <br />• Distributed City-wide Annual Report to Commissioners; <br />• Staff is currently working on a City-wide Strategic Plan which will be presented to the Council later in <br />May. <br />• Staff is also working on expanding CIP to a 10 -year plan. <br />• T -Mobile has not had any more contact on the possible tower addition in Acorn Park. <br />• Geothermal Update: <br />o All proposals are substantially over budget, 75-150% higher than the feasibility study estimates.. <br />o Costing reviews are taking place in the pre -award phase. <br />o If there is an opportunity to value engineer portions of the project and not compromise the <br />outcome, it will be considered. <br />9.
